>    > It is now known that the samsung F4 has a buggy firmware that causes
>    > 64 sectors of data to randomly be discarded from the write cache when
>    > an ATA command to identify the device is executed during a disk write.
>    > I have 3 F4 and I have verified that the issue does exist on my
>    > drives. Samsung is aware of this bug and is working on a fix.
